Output 00031a90b1eecbe97b7aa015c769400cc0ed3e06e65c659dd5b71ce958931f22:4

value
178267466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e7684452322c42a530f10f4df224280af96798 OP_EQUAL
address
37hV4UQPrD2xXFCHf4aXM9iKDfav8Ls3yP
transaction
00031a90b1eecbe97b7aa015c769400cc0ed3e06e65c659dd5b71ce958931f22